Skip to content

Commit 5f82eeb

Browse files
committed
Fixed module_stomping
1 parent 8fab0f1 commit 5f82eeb

File tree

1 file changed

+2
-3
lines changed

1 file changed

+2
-3
lines changed

module_stomping/src/main.rs

+2-3
Original file line numberDiff line numberDiff line change
@@ -87,8 +87,7 @@ fn main() {
8787
addr_of_mut!(needed),
8888
);
8989
let count = (needed as usize) / size_of::<HMODULE>();
90-
for i in 0..count {
91-
let module = modules[i];
90+
for module in modules.into_iter().take(count) {
9291
let mut name: [u8; 128] = zeroed();
9392
GetModuleBaseNameA(
9493
handle,
@@ -123,7 +122,7 @@ fn main() {
123122
);
124123
};
125124

126-
CloseHandle(handle);
127125
}
126+
CloseHandle(handle);
128127
}
129128
}

0 commit comments

Comments
 (0)